Overview Migrest Solo Tablet

Migraine prevention is the purpose of Migrest Solo Tablets. These tablets are prophylactic, not abortive; migraine prevention ceases upon discontinuation. Their mechanism involves brain relaxation, thus mitigating migraine onset. Migrest Solo Tablets can be administered with or without food, but consistent daily timing ensures therapeutic blood levels. Adherence to the prescribed regimen is crucial; missed doses should be taken promptly, and the full course completed regardless of symptom improvement. Treatment should continue as directed by your physician; abrupt cessation is inadvisable. Reported adverse effects include myalgia, lassitude, constipation, nausea, somnolence, rhinorrhea, increased hunger, dysphoria, gastrointestinal distress, and mastalgia. Initial drowsiness may impair alertness; avoid driving or operating machinery until the effect is known. Weight gain is possible; a healthy diet and exercise are recommended for mitigation. Mood alterations, including depression, may occur, necessitating behavioral monitoring. Pregnant or lactating individuals should seek medical counsel before commencing treatment.

How Migrest Solo Tablet works:

The dilation of cranial blood vessels is believed to trigger migraine headaches. Migrest Solo Tablets counteract this process by maintaining vascular tone and preventing vessel expansion, thereby averting migraine onset.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holUNSAFE

Taking Migrest Solo Tablets with alcohol can lead to significant sleepiness.

PregnancyPreg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Data on Migrest Solo Tablet use in pregnancy are lacking. Seek medical advice from your physician.

Breast feedingBreast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Data on Migrest Solo Tablet use while breastfeeding is absent. Seek medical advice from your physician.

DrivingDriving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Migrest Solo Tablet's effect on driving ability is undetermined. Refrain from driving if you exhibit symptoms impairing concentration or reaction time.

KidneyKidneySAFE IF PRESCRIBED

Migrest Solo Tablets are likely safe for individuals with kidney impairment. Existing evidence indicates dose modification may be unnecessary. Physician consultation is recommended. However, individuals with severe kidney disease should seek medical advice before use.

LiverLiverCAUTION

Patients with liver impairment should use Migrest Solo Tablet cautiously, potentially requiring a modified dosage. Physician consultation is advised.

FAQs on Migrest Solo Tablet

Migrest Solo Tablets are safe when taken as directed by a doctor.
Migrest Solo Tablets, a calcium channel blocker, prevent migraine attacks. Migraines are recurring headaches, typically throbbing on one side of the head, often with nausea and visual disturbances.
Migrest Solo Tablets may cause weight gain due to increased appetite. Maintaining your normal diet may help prevent this. Consult your doctor if you gain weight while taking Migrest Solo Tablets.
